Zyryanka vs Ezeiza Climate & Distance Between

Argentina flag
  • The distance between Zyryanka, Russia and Ezeiza, Argentina is approximately 16,070 km or 9,986 mi.
  • To reach Zyryanka in this distance one would set out from Ezeiza bearing 339.6°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Zyryanka bearing 224° or SW .
  • Zyryanka has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Ezeiza has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Zyryanka is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Ezeiza is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 28 °C (50.4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 37.8 °C (68°F) more in Zyryanka. The continentality subtype is hypercont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 718.3 mm (28.3 in) less which is equivalent to 718.3 l/m² (17.63 US gal/ft²) or 7,183,000 l/ha (767,910 US gal/ac) less. About 1/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 30.1° lower in Zyryanka than in Ezeiza.
  • Relative humidity levels are 0.8%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 26.6°C (47.8°F) lower.
